Q: Is 513,160,323 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 513,160,323 is a composite number.

Why is 513,160,323 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 513,160,323 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 43 129 559 1,677 305,999 917,997 3,977,987 11,933,961 13,157,957 39,473,871 171,053,441 and 513,160,323, with no remainder.

Since 513,160,323 cannot be divided by just 1 and 513,160,323, it is a composite number.
